Output 6566bc93e1a5f41414f20a43386a245d051bdabe5edb2ac0d6cfcd529e540313:1

value
4098312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70ce744ae86ba1bcd3bc0d6151b31f0247ff68e OP_EQUAL
address
3QDJHUAnjrKVBUYiudJrS4zxPdcREc13Lw
transaction
6566bc93e1a5f41414f20a43386a245d051bdabe5edb2ac0d6cfcd529e540313
confirmations
322066
spent
true